Pre - operation Safety Precautions

Training and Familiarization

Before any operator uses the wire bending testing machine, they must receive comprehensive training. This training should cover the basic operation of the machine, including how to load the wire samples, set the testing parameters, and start and stop the machine. Operators should also be familiar with the machine's control panel, emergency stop buttons, and other safety features. It is recommended that new operators work under the supervision of experienced personnel until they are fully confident in their abilities.

Machine Inspection

Prior to each use, a thorough inspection of the wire bending testing machine is essential. Check for any visible signs of damage, such as cracks in the frame, loose wires, or worn - out parts. Ensure that all safety guards are in place and properly secured. These guards are designed to prevent operators from coming into contact with moving parts during the testing process. Inspect the power cord for any signs of fraying or damage, and make sure that the machine is properly grounded to prevent electrical hazards.

Sample Preparation

Proper sample preparation is crucial for both accurate test results and safety. Select wire samples that are appropriate for the testing machine's specifications. Cut the samples to the correct length, and ensure that the ends are smooth and free of burrs. Improperly prepared samples can cause the machine to malfunction or pose a risk to the operator. For example, a sharp - edged sample might cause injury during handling or damage the machine's bending mechanism.

Operational Safety Precautions

Personal Protective Equipment (PPE)

Operators must wear appropriate personal protective equipment at all times when using the wire bending testing machine. This includes safety glasses to protect the eyes from flying debris, gloves to prevent cuts and abrasions, and hearing protection if the machine produces excessive noise. Depending on the nature of the testing, additional PPE such as safety shoes and aprons may also be required.

Machine Operation

When operating the wire bending testing machine, follow the manufacturer's instructions carefully. Set the testing parameters, such as the bending angle, speed, and number of cycles, according to the requirements of the test. Do not exceed the machine's rated capacity, as this can lead to equipment failure and potential safety hazards. During the testing process, keep a safe distance from the moving parts of the machine. Do not attempt to adjust or repair the machine while it is in operation.

Emergency Stop Procedures

Familiarize yourself with the location and operation of the emergency stop button on the wire bending testing machine. In case of an emergency, such as a malfunction or an operator getting too close to the moving parts, immediately press the emergency stop button. This will stop the machine's operation and prevent further damage or injury. After pressing the emergency stop button, follow the proper restart procedures to ensure that the machine is functioning correctly.

Monitoring the Testing Process

While the wire bending testing machine is in operation, operators should continuously monitor the process. Watch for any signs of abnormal behavior, such as unusual noises, vibrations, or changes in the testing speed. If any issues are detected, stop the machine immediately and investigate the cause. Do not ignore these warning signs, as they could indicate a serious problem with the machine or the test samples.

Post - operation Safety Precautions

Machine Shutdown

After completing the testing process, follow the proper shutdown procedures for the wire bending testing machine. Turn off the power switch and unplug the machine from the electrical outlet. This will prevent any accidental startup and reduce the risk of electrical hazards. If the machine has a cooling system, allow it to cool down before performing any maintenance or cleaning.

Cleaning and Maintenance

Regular cleaning and maintenance of the wire bending testing machine are essential for its safe and efficient operation. Remove any wire debris or dust from the machine using a soft brush or compressed air. Clean the bending mechanism and other moving parts to prevent the buildup of dirt and debris, which can affect the machine's performance. Check the lubrication levels of the machine and add lubricant as needed. Inspect all parts for wear and tear, and replace any damaged parts promptly.

Record - keeping

Maintain a detailed record of the machine's operation, including the date of use, testing parameters, and any issues or maintenance performed. This record - keeping will help in tracking the machine's performance over time and identifying any potential safety issues. It can also be useful for compliance with industry regulations and quality control standards.

Additional Safety Considerations

Environmental Factors

The environment in which the wire bending testing machine is used can also affect safety. Ensure that the machine is placed in a clean, dry, and well - ventilated area. Avoid using the machine in areas with high humidity, as this can cause corrosion of the machine's parts. Keep the work area free of clutter to prevent tripping hazards.

Hazardous Materials

If the wire samples being tested contain hazardous materials, such as lead or other heavy metals, additional safety precautions must be taken. Operators should be trained on how to handle these materials safely, and appropriate disposal methods should be followed. Ensure that the testing area is properly ventilated to prevent the inhalation of harmful fumes.

Regular Maintenance and Calibration

Schedule regular maintenance and calibration of the wire bending testing machine. This will ensure that the machine is operating accurately and safely. A calibrated machine will provide more reliable test results, which is crucial for quality control and product development. During maintenance, have a qualified technician inspect the machine's internal components, check the accuracy of the sensors and controls, and perform any necessary repairs or adjustments.
